Kristina and Jeff picked some of my favorite Chicago locations for their session so I couldn’t have been more excited when their scheduled weekend rolled around!

We started at the Wrigley Building, which, despite being crowded this time of year, is always a gorgeous view. Something about the way the colors and textures all mix together over there – it really brings out some of the best of Chicago! We then walked around Wacker Drive, stopping at different points to capture some lovely city views. And a quick pop down to the Riverwalk for a change of scenery is always a good idea! For the second half of the session we went to the ever so elegant Union Station. Those big beautiful columns are so regal and make for such wonderful backdrops for any occasion.
